An intricately carved wooden structure designed as a home temple or puja mandir, featuring a tiered pyramidal roof, ornate columns, and a platform for deities and offerings. The structure is rendered in a medium brown wood tone, suggesting materials like teak or rosewood. Small bells hang from the roof corners, and the interior displays miniature idols, floral garlands, and various food offerings on a green base. — 3D model

What is the primary purpose of this carved wooden structure?
The primary purpose of this object is to serve as a home temple or puja mandir for Hindu religious worship, providing a dedicated and sacred space for deities and devotional practices.
What materials are typically used in the construction of such a home temple?
These home temples are traditionally crafted from various types of wood, such as teak, rosewood, or mango wood, known for their durability and suitability for intricate carving. Some may include brass accents.
Does this type of home temple require assembly?
Many intricately carved home temples are often delivered fully assembled, or with minimal assembly required for certain detachable components like pillars or decorative finials, ensuring structural integrity.
